What is a Robot Vacuum Cleaner?

Robot vacuum cleaners are autonomous devices that browse throughout the home, utilizing sensors and navigation technologies to tidy floors while minimizing human intervention. Unlike standard vacuum, robot vacuums are designed to run individually, going back to their charging station when they need to dock and recharge. The integration of clever technology also permits these gadgets to be controlled through smartphone applications or clever home systems.

Features of Robot Vacuum Cleaners

The abilities of robot vacuum cleaners have actually expanded considerably for many years. Here are some common features found in modern models:

  1. Suction Power: Varies amongst models, with some providing high suction for deep cleaning carpets.
  2. Navigation Technology:
  • Lidar (Light Detection and Ranging)
  • Camera-based navigation
  • Gyroscope sensing units
  1. Smart Home Integration: Compatible with virtual ass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.
  2. Scheduled Cleaning: Allows users to set particular times for the vacuum to operate autonomously.
  3. Self-Emptying Dust Bins: Some models feature a base that automatically empties the device's dustbin.
  4. Multi-Surface Capability: Suitable for both carpets and difficult floorings.
  5. Anti-Tangle Design: Brushes that minimize contending hair or strings.
  6. Virtual Boundaries: Users can set barriers so that the robot avoids particular areas or spaces.

Considerations When Choosing a Robot Vacuum Cleaner

In spite of their various benefits, possible buyers should consider a number of factors to ensure they select the best robot vacuum for their needs:

  1. Home Size and Layout: Larger homes may need designs with effective batteries and advanced navigation.
  2. Kind of Flooring: Some designs perform better on carpets, while others stand out on hard floors.
  3. Pets: Homeowners with family pets ought to try to find designs developed to handle family pet hair and dander.
  4. Spending plan: Robot vacuums range commonly in price, from spending plan models to high-end gadgets with advanced functions.
  5. Upkeep: Consider the expense of changing filters and brushes, and the ease of cleaning the gadget itself.
  6. Noise Level: Some models run silently while others can be disruptive during cleaning cycles.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can robot vacuum clean all kinds of surfaces?Yes, a lot of contemporary robot vacuum cleaners are developed to deal with a variety of surfaces, including carpets, tile, and wood floorings. However, it is recommended to inspect the specifications of specific models as some might be much better matched for particular surface areas.

2. For how long does a robot vacuum operate on a single charge?The battery life of robot vacuum varies by design, normally lasting anywhere from 60 to 120 minutes. Larger homes with more square footage may require models with prolonged battery life.

3. Do  robot mop  require a great deal of upkeep?Maintenance requirements depend upon the design, however a lot of need periodic emptying of the dustbin, cleaning of brushes, and replacement of filters. Some models feature self-emptying bases that decrease maintenance.

4. Are robot vacuums reliable at getting family pet hair?Many robot vacuums include specialized brushes and effective suction developed specifically for animal hair. Those particularly suited for pet owners can effectively handle hair and dander.

5. Can robot vacuum cleaners map my home?Numerous advanced designs come equipped with mapping technology, enabling them to produce a design of your home for more efficient cleaning. This feature can likewise make it possible for users to set virtual limits.
